Introduction to styrene: on March 30, domestic styrene market low
Guide to styrene: Yesterday, the domestic styrene market was at a low level. From this point of view, the global economy is now being impacted by the coronavirus, and the overseas epidemic situation is becoming increasingly fierce. The market demand is not optimistic, the terminal demand is not smooth, and the weak situation is difficult to change temporarily. Future forecast: pay attention to the change of epidemic situation and financial policy.
